Transforming Mindsets: Nurturing Growth from Fixed Foundations | Zulfiya Obidova | TEDxCAU Women

In her talk Zulfiya Obidova explains why girls are more prone to have a fixed mindset because of the social, cultural and parental expectations. As she counts these reasons, she also gives some ideas as to how we can foster a growth mindset in our daughters especially. She believes that by applying the techniques she suggests, parents and educators can help girls develop a growth mindset, empowering them to pursue their goals with confidence and resilience. Zulfiyakhon Obidova is the founder and CEO of Invento – The Uzbek International School, dedicated to transforming education in Uzbekistan. Passionate about growth mindset development and gender equality in learning, she strives to create opportunities for all students to learn, grow, and lead. Her personal journey led her to fall in love with the IB system, recognizing its transformative impact on students. She believes in its ability to shape young minds by developing both soft and hard skills, preparing them for a rapidly changing world. Through her leadership, she champions a future where education unlocks the full potential of every child.
